Default Bitpim vs GAGIN on a530?

I was wondering which was easier to use with the a530? I have never used GAGIN before and have only used Bitpim on the LG VX4400 so I didn't have to really mess with the filesystem stuff, since I was just putting ringtones and pics on the phone. I know for GAGIN you have to use balpatch9 as well, is this the case with using Bitpim as well? I have never actually seen instructions posted on how to use Bitpim from start to finish on the a530. Can someone post instructions? I am sure there are plenty of us out there that would really appreciate it, especially if it's easier to use then GAGIN. Thanks.

Default Bitpim vs GAGIN on a530? Instructions for Bitpim?

I agree. If you are just adding ringtones and pics you may find bitpim a whole lot easier the gagin. But be warn that bitpim was designed for the 4400 even though myself and others had success uploading ringtones and pics. You have to add ring tones through log mode, your not able view phone or download phonebooks and other info like the 4400. just view files from log view then click open the directory that stores your ringer, right click then choose add a file, browse to the file and save.

Default Bitpim vs GAGIN on a530? Instructions for Bitpim?

Vince or anyone that can help,

I am using Bitpim and I got the ringtones to work and also was able to upload a caller id picture, but I am struggling with getting a picture for wallpaper on the phone. I have been trying to put it in the same /brew/shared directory as the caller id pics. At first the filename was showing up with the last callerid pic that I had already uploaded. Now, I got the wallpaper on the phone after changing the pic to 24 bit instead of 16, but the colors are screwed up. Am I doing something wrong? I am using the 128x128 24bit bitmaps. I thought I should be using 16 bit, but they didn't show up at all?
